Job Description

About the Role


We are seeking a highly skilled Senior Java Developer to join our dynamic technology team in Dubai. In this role, you will design, develop, and maintain scalable Java applications using Spring Boot and microservices architecture, collaborate with cross-functional teams, and mentor junior developers to drive technical excellence and deliver high-quality solutions.


Responsibilities



  • Architect, design, and implement Java applications using Spring Boot

  • Develop and maintain microservices to support scalable, high-availability systems

  • Collaborate with product owners, architects, QA, and operations teams to define requirements and deliver solutions

  • Perform code reviews, enforce coding standards, and mentor junior developers

  • Optimize application performance, troubleshoot issues, and implement best practices

  • Participate in Agile ceremon...

Apply for this Position

Ready to join TASC Outsourcing? Click the button below to submit your application.

Submit Application